Wedding Photography Shots Before the Ceremony

  • Bride and bridesmaids getting ready
  • Groom and groomsmen getting ready
  • Bride pinning corsage/boutonniere on mother/father
  • Groom pinning corsage/boutonniere on mother/father
  • Shots of ceremony & reception location (decorated/empty)
  • Portraits of wedding guests during cocktail hour (against backdrop)

Wedding Photography Shots At the Ceremony

  • Outside of ceremony site
  • Guests walking into ceremony site
  • Bride and father entering ceremony site
  • Parents being seated
  • Maid of honor walking down the aisle
  • Bridesmaids walking down the aisle
  • Groom waiting for bride
  • Ceremony musicians
  • Officiant
  • Altar or canopy during ceremony
  • Bride and father walking down aisle
  • Groom seeing bride for first time
  • The back of bride and father walking down the aisle
  • Bride’s father and Bride hugging at end of aisle
  • Shot of the audience from the bride and groom’s point of view
  • The unity ceremony
  • Close up of bride and groom saying the vows
  • Wide shot of bride and groom saying the vows
  • Exchanging the rings
  • Close up of hands
  • The kiss
  • Bride & Groom walking up the aisle

Posed Wedding Photography Before the Reception

These can also be taken before the ceremony

  • Bride alone (full length)
  • Bride with Maid of Honor
  • Bride with bridesmaids
  • Groom with bridesmaids
  • Bride with parents
  • Bride & Groom together
  • Bride & Groom with parents
  • Bride & Groom with families
  • Bride & Groom with entire wedding party
  • Groom with parents
  • Groom with best man
  • Groom with groomsmen
  • Bride with groomsmen

During the Reception

To help your photographer, you may wish to list these shots in the order they will happen at your reception.

  • Outside of reception site
  • Bride & Groom arriving
  • Bride & Groom greeting guests
  • Table centerpieces
  • Table setting
  • Musicians or DJ
  • Place card table
  • Wedding cake
  • A shot of bride & groom with guests at each table
  • The buffet or, if having table service, a dinner serving
  • Bride & Groom’s first dance
  • Bride & Father dancing
  • Groom & Mother dancing
  • Guests dancing
  • Bride & Groom cutting the cake
  • Bride & Groom feeding each other cake
  • Toasts (specify who is giving them (M.O.H.: Alicia Hatch / B.M: Ian Russell)
  • Bride throwing bouquet
  • Groom retrieving garter
  • Groom tossing garter
  • The getaway car
  • Bride & Groom leaving party
  • Bride & Groom driving away
